TicketMaster vs. eBay and StubHubYesterday, TicketMaster announced that they will be suing eBay Inc. and StubHub, a property owned by eBay over interference of contractual rights.  Ticketmaster is owned by IAC/InterActiveCorp. 

eBay had acquired StubHub on January 10 for $310 million and last month, TicketsNow another company with a similar service-line raised $34 million in funding. 

The lawsuit was filed at the Los Angeles County Superior Court and the case focuses on a specific music tour.  The lawsuit filed by Ticketmaster implies Ticketmaster does not approve of the secondary ticketing market.
